AMENITIES & TRANSPORT LINKS

Montrose is a popular, picturesque coastal town located midway between the cities of Dundee and Aberdeen on the East coast. The town has an excellent range of local services for its residents, including a variety of shops, health and sports centres, museum, cinema, library, swimming pool and the beautiful beach, Montrose Basin and harbour.

Serviced by the main East Coast railway line makes it an ideal commuter’s base to locate. Montrose railway station is about 15 minutes to walk. Bus and rail link the cities as well as easy road travel access to the surrounding Angus and Aberdeenshire towns. Aberdeen and Dundee cities are approximately 45 minutes driving time.

Angus area offers great sporting pursuits and Montrose is known for the Golf Links and having the world’s 5th oldest golf course sitting next to its attractive beach. The town centre and restaurants are nearby all in easy walking distance of this property. Montrose Academy is nearby for the children to walk easily.
